None of the troopers carry an E11 on Ferrix. Also, In my opinion, the backpack should not be included. That trooper is a completely different look. No armor, etc. I would go as far to say it would be a completely different CRL, as he wears no armor at all. But also, as far a I know, we only see half the backpack, so completing it might be nigh impossible as it is. If it were me, I would keep this armored security trooper separate from the soft goods only variant. It's not quite as interchangeable as the Aldani troopers are, who are seen in many forms of dress. Here they are either fully armored, or in soft goods only. Just my two cents.
